要在Linux上启用UART,您需要执行以下步骤:
1. 确保您的Linux内核已编译并加载了UART驱动程序。您可以通过检查`/dev/ttyS*`设备文件来验证它们是否存在。
2. 如果您的系统上没有UART设备文件,则需要编辑内核配置文件并重新编译内核以启用UART支持。您可以使用`make menuconfig`或`make xconfig`等命令来编辑内核配置。
3. 在内核配置中,找到UART驱动程序的选项,通常位于"Device Drivers"或"Serial drivers"部分。启用所需的UART驱动程序选项,例如UART 8250或其他特定于您的硬件的选项。
4. 保存配置并重新编译内核。根据您的系统和配置,这可能需要一些时间。
5. 完成重新编译后,将新的内核映像文件复制到适当的位置,并更新引导加载程序以引导新内核。
6. 重新启动系统,并验证UART是否已成功启用。您可以使用`dmesg`命令查看启动日志,以确认UART驱动程序是否已加载。
一旦UART已启用,您可以使用串口工具(如minicom或screen)来与UART设备进行通信。确保正确配置串口参数(如波特率、数据位、停止位和校验位)以与您的设备匹配。